#695ff5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#695ff5 is composed of 41.2% red, 37.3% green and 96.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.1% cyan, 61.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 244 degrees, a saturation of 88.2% and a lightness of 66.7%. #695ff5 color hex could be obtained by blending #d2beff with #0000eb.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

#695ff5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#695ff5 has RGB values of R:105, G:95, B:245 and CMYK values of C:0.57, M:0.61,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 6905845.

Shades and Tints of #695ff5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010006 is the darkest color, while #f3f3f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#695ff5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a7a7ad is the less saturated color, while #6358fc is the most saturated one.
